Chicago businessman Tahawwur Rana has been sentenced to 14 years in prison for providing material support to Pakistani terror group, the Lakshar-e-Taiba or the LeT, in its failed attempt to attack the Danish Newspaper that printed cartoons of the Prophet Mohammad. Rana's three week-long trial also established that the LeT was behind the 26/11 Mumbai attack that left over 160 dead.
